10 Tips for Reducing Allergens in Your Home:

1. Opt for smooth, uncluttered surfaces that are easy to clean.
2. Keep small objects in drawers or closed cabinets.
3. Avoid using your bedroom as a library or study room.
4. Reduce furniture to a minimum and use synthetic fabrics.
5. Encase mattresses in airtight covers and wash bedding weekly in hot water.
6. Remove carpeting and vacuum with a HEPA filter or wear a dust mask.
7. Control humidity to below 50% with central air conditioning or dehumidifiers.
8. Use household cleaners to keep surfaces clear of mold and other sources of allergens.
9. Consider air cleaning devices to remove or control the source of allergens.
10.Remember to also avoid other irritants like to***co smoke and aerosol powder.

A short information about HDM - house dust mite

Did you know that house dust is not just the dust that blows in from outdoors? It's actually produced indoors from fibers and breakdown of plant and animal materials in the house! These materials include feathers, cotton, wool, jute, h**p, and animal hair, which can be found in items like mattresses, pillows, quilts, upholstered furniture, and carpets. I recommend regular cleaning to keep your home healthy and dust-free.

If you're experiencing allergies at home, it might be due to house dust mites. These pesky allergens thrive in environments with high humidity and can be found throughout the house, but particularly on surfaces where human dander accumulates, like mattresses, pillows, and carpets. Make sure to keep your indoor humidity levels in check and regularly clean these surfaces to reduce the presence of dust mites in your home.
